Output 8660fffe66d6a53072e2ae38fd299372633ad9e0079252ce1760ffd0b16da6bc:0

value
398010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be1d661857651551d4d55535da70f47ffc9a8769 OP_EQUAL
address
3K2FXf31nPp7CH3GHGU2VXKjtRYskVmBNz
transaction
8660fffe66d6a53072e2ae38fd299372633ad9e0079252ce1760ffd0b16da6bc
spent
true